Plaquenil has been a godsend, but you have to accept that you may experience horrific diahrea in the beginning but there are over a dozen generics and chances are you’ll find one you can easily tolerate. Make sure you keep copious notes of manufacturers, doses and side-effects. My insurance co refused to pay for the name brand, which I knew from past experience had zero side-effects for me and worked like a charm. My pharmacists are absolute angels (Costco for the win!) They told me there are dozens of manufacturers and that we’ll just go through them until we find one that doesn’t upset my stomach. It took several months, and you have to take literal notes on what medical manufacturer you’re using as what dosage and what the daily side effects are. It’s a balancing act of knowing the diahrea may go away as your body acclimates to the drug, or that your symptoms aren’t getting better and it’s time to move on. Good news is they did find one only 3 drugs in. I take two at breakfast, taking them at night causes severe sleep disturbances for me. I also had to eat a more solid breakfast. Adding oatmeal did the trick as well as eliminating that morning glass of milk.Turns out all the different companies manufacturing Hydroxyquloroquine (the scientific name) use fillers that they are not obligated to identify (thanks FDA). Those fillers are what many people are allergic to. I’m disabled by this disease and needed some help BAD. Was it worth it? 1000% percent. It’s a gradual symptom decline and I’m still seeing small little improvements. You will also HAVE to have your eyes checked by an Opthalmologist, it is rarely known to cause problems but the issue can be harmful so you’ll need to have your eyes checked. I went today actually, had the dilation and photography and all the tests which they say can take 4 hours but I was it in less than two. All good. I wish you the best.
